Itinerary and Highlights
The Full Day Chalten tour begins with a pickup from El Calafate hotels. Guests will embark on a scenic journey along Route 40, skirting Lake Argentino and crossing the Santa Cruz and La Leona rivers. Upon arrival in El Chaltén, visitors will explore the town’s Interpretation Center before embarking on an easy 1.25-hour hike to the Condor Lookout, offering stunning views of Cerro Torre and Mount Fitz Roy. Lunch at a local restaurant and an optional 30-minute hike to the Chorrillo del Salto waterfall are also part of the itinerary, leaving one hour of free time to further explore El Chaltén.

Pickup and Transport
The tour begins with pickup from hotels in El Calafate, where guests board a comfortable vehicle.
From there, the scenic journey along Route 40 offers stunning views as it skirts Lake Argentino.
After crossing the Santa Cruz and La Leona rivers, the group arrives at the charming town of El Chaltén.
This transfer showcases the region’s beautiful landscapes, setting the stage for the day’s adventures.
Hiking and Viewpoints
Upon arrival in El Chaltén, the group sets out on an easy hike to the Condor Lookout, which offers stunning vistas of the iconic Cerro Torre and Mount Fitz Roy.
The 1.25-hour trail provides a chance to take in the majestic landscape and spot wildlife along the way. After reaching the lookout, travelers enjoy a well-earned lunch at a local restaurant.
For those seeking an additional adventure, a 30-minute hike to the Chorrillo del Salto waterfall is available.
The day culminates with an hour of free time to explore the charming town of El Chaltén, allowing visitors to soak in the unique atmosphere and culture of this Patagonian gem.
